Echinacea has been used since ancient times by Native American Tribes in order to prevent or treat frequent health problems such as cold or influenza symptoms. It was also used by Native Americans in order to keep infections away and it was "universally used as an antidote for snakebite and other venomous bites and stings and poisonous conditions. Echinacea seems to have been used as a remedy for more ailments than any other plant," anthropologist Melvin Gilmore notes in his well-known Uses of Plants by Indians of the Missouri River Region, published in 1919.

After discovering the various positive effects Echinacea has on our health, Europeans also began to use it extensively in order to cure different ailments or serious conditions or simply for preserving their health intact. In the 1930s Dr. Gerhard Madaus, a German scientist, carried out extended studies on this miraculous herbal healer and also developed the Echinacin curing product. Echinacin is a natural juice made from the flowers, leaves and stems of Echinacea that is used by an extremely high number of people across the world for treating all kinds of health impairments.

Echinacea's miraculous powers lie in its ingredients, as this herb is laden with vitamins A, C, and E and a large number of nutritive minerals - copper, iron, potassium and the halogen iodine. It is also rich in all kinds of antioxidant and other beneficial elements such as: oils, polysaccharides, phenols (cichoric, caffeic, and caftaric acids and echinacoside), flavonoids and alkylamides.

Modern medicine findings show that Echinacea functions upon our health by stimulating and strengthening our body's immune system. Besides stimulating the T cells of the immune system, the herb was proven to slow and even prevent the formation of an enzyme called hyaluronidase in our organism.

This enzyme is found in reptile venom and functions by dissolving the gel-like substance present around human cells, that protects them from exterior infectious factors. Hyaluronidase in the venom helps increasing, in this way, the rate of its absorption by the human body and this is how it becomes extremely harmful to our health.

Hyaluronidase enzyme is also used by other dangerous bacteria to dissolve the connective tissue in our body and to get more easily and deeper into our bodies. Therefore, the enzyme increases the permeability of connective tissue and the absorption of fluids. But Echinacea helps the body by annihilating its formation.
